

A much-loved father, grandfather and friend, David H. Sarchet, 84, passed away in his home October 12, 2015 in Platteville, Colorado. He battled COPD in his last few years, confronting the slow progressive disease head on. He was born on February 9, 1931 in Platteville, Colorado to Dwight and Hazel (Martin) Sarchet. He graduated from Platteville High School in 1949. He married Joyce Bateman in Fort Lupton in 1951, sharing their union until her death in 2006.
At an early age, David was happiest working with his hands and farming the land. It was in his blood from several generations of farmers before him. He never had a need to travel very far away from “his place”. He had a knack for being inventive and applied his talents to most everything he touched. Preferring to fix or build, was a joy he cherished and everything David did had a purpose and a plan. Stories, as a young man from moving small houses singlehandedly to an attempt to constructing a helicopter, were evidence of his character. He was a very patient, generous and loving man. David loved going to his mountain cabin, watching over his fields of alfalfa and wheat and the companionship of his old, sweet and loyal dog “Sammy”. David liked simple pleasures and will be remembered by his invitations to share them with us all; sharing popcorn and peanuts, going to eat a burger, drinking a Coors, constructing numerous jigsaw puzzles or watching a good ol’ western. We will miss him greatly.
